GTS is an acronym that stands for “Go To Sleep.” It’s a common phrase used in texting and on social media platforms like Snapchat. When someone sends you “GTS,” they are essentially suggesting that you should consider going to bed or that they themselves are heading to bed. The context usually indicates whether it’s a suggestion or a statement of intent. In the Snapchat universe, where brevity is key, acronyms like GTS help users communicate quickly and efficiently. Snapchat is a platform known for its ephemeral messaging and visual content, which often leads to a more casual style of communication. Therefore, GTS fits right into the Snapchat lexicon as an easy shorthand for closing a conversation late at night or when someone is feeling tired. Outside of Snapchat, GTS is also widely used in general texting. It carries the same meaning across different platforms, making it a versatile term for anyone who frequently communicates via text messages. Whether you’re chatting with a friend, a family member, or a colleague, GTS is a handy acronym to express the need for sleep without typing out the entire phrase.
